Output 9c10a423431f6a17b167ceebe89713cefb5987dcedbe39f7f3b0618ffd806cf1:3

value
25659647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a284d376f33d43857690929b49a53ca31f5ea1c OP_EQUAL
address
MDCfhmBHaSHqwL6nFfAdS6mW2rKydnL15T
transaction
9c10a423431f6a17b167ceebe89713cefb5987dcedbe39f7f3b0618ffd806cf1
spent
true